We used anEscherichia coli strain blocked in serine biosynthesis and carrying a partialglyA deletion to isolate strains with altered regulation of theglyA gene. TheglyA deletion results in 25% of the normal serine hydroxymethyltransferase activity. Three classes of mutants with increasedglyA expression were isolated on glycine supplemented plates. One class of mutations increasedglyA expression 10-fold by directly altering the – 35 consensus sequence of theglyA promoter. The two other classes increasedglyA expression about 2- and 6-fold, respectively. The latter two classes of mutations also affected regulation of themetE gene of the folate branch of the methionine pathway, but notmetA in the nonfolate branch of the methionine pathway, or thegcv operon, encoding the glycine cleavage enzyme system. The mutations were mapped to about minute 85.5 on theE. coli chromosome.  相似文献

Regulation of the metR gene of Salmonella typhimurium.   总被引:15,自引:9,他引:6       下载免费PDF全文
Regulation of the Salmonella typhimurium metR gene was studied by measuring beta-galactosidase levels in Escherichia coli strains lysogenic for a lambda bacteriophage carrying a metR-lacZ fusion. The results indicate that the metR gene is negatively regulated by its own gene product and that this autoregulation involves homocysteine as a corepressor. In addition, the results indicate that the metR gene is negatively regulated by the metJ gene product over a 70- to 80-fold range.  相似文献

The glycine-cleavage enzyme system of Escherichia coli has been cloned in the cosmid vector pMF7. The recombinant plasmid, designated pGS64, carries two 19.4-kb EcoRI insert fragments. One of these fragments, which carries the gcv system, was subcloned from plasmid pGS64 into the plasmid vectors pACYC184 and pSC101 (creating plasmids pGS96 and pGS97, respectively). Plasmid pGS97, but not pGS96, complements a gcv mutant on glycine-supplemented plates. Enzyme assays, however, verified that both plasmids carry an inducible gcv system. The location of the gcv system in plasmid pGS97 was determined by Tn5 insertional inactivation. Subcloning experiments identified the region on the 19.4-kb fragment that inhibits growth in strains transformed with plasmid pGS96 and a region that is possibly involved in negative regulation of the gcv system.  相似文献

Hyperoxaluria is a complication of disorders associated with steatorrhea. The colon is the presumed site of enhanced oxalate absorption in patients with steatorrhea. We performed studies of colonic mucosal oxalate uptake in everted sacs of rat colon to determine the kinetics of colonic oxalate transport and to evaluate the effect of both pH and ricinoleic acid, a hydroxy fatty acid, on colonic oxalate uptake. Our study demonstrated that oxalate is transported throughout the colon by passive diffusion. Tissue uptake increased linearly with increasing oxalate concentrations and was unaffected by metabolic inhibitors, oxygen deprivation, or temperature changes. There were pH-dependent regional differences of oxalate uptake both in the presence and absence of ricinoleic acid. In the absence of ricinoleic acid, the highest oxalate uptake occurred at the lower pH values (5.4 and 6.4). In the presence of ricinoleic acid oxalate uptake was enhanced at the higher pH values (7.4 and 8.4); a finding most likely related to decreased solubility of ricinoleic acid at pH 5.4 and 6.4. Intraluminal pH is an important determinant of colonic oxalate uptake in the presence and absence of ricinoleic acid.  相似文献

Summary Immature pollen of two varieties of Triticum aestivum, at the stage right after the first pollen mitosis, was isolated from individual anthers and cultured in microcultures of microliter droplets. In a specifically designed medium, some of the pollen grains developed to maturity. These were applied to excised stigmas on agar, where they produced pollen tubes. Application to flowers in vivo led to seed set. Pollen was matured in vitro from a variety that produced a different protein banding pattern on SDS-PAGE as compared to the variety that was pollinated. The protein banding in the produced seeds showed the hybrid pattern, demonstrating that the seeds were not produced by self-pollination in this in-breeding species but by pollination with the in-vitro-matured pollen.  相似文献

The Salmonella typhimurium metE and metR genes share a common control region, with overlapping, divergently transcribed promoters. A double gene fusion was constructed in which the metE promoter directs expression of the Escherichia coli lacZ gene and the metR promoter directs expression of the E. coli galK gene. By using an E. coli strain lysogenized with a lambda bacteriophage carrying the metE-lacZ metR-galK double fusion (lambda Elac.Rgal), two classes of cis-acting mutations were isolated that increase metR-galK expression. The first class of mutations causes a simultaneous decrease in metE-lacZ expression by disrupting the normal MetR-mediated activation of the metE promoter. The mutations are located within a region extending from 17 to 34 base pairs upstream of the -35 region of the metE promoter. Gel mobility shift assays and DNaseI protection experiments demonstrated that the MetR protein specifically binds to a 24-base-pair region encompassing these mutations. The second class of mutations increases metR-galK expression by directly altering the promoter consensus sequences of the metE and metR promoters.  相似文献

Colony isolates of the fungus Emericellopsis glabra, developing from ultraviolet (UV)-irradiated conidia, were examined for variability on the basis of colony morphology, loss of antibiotic-producing capacity on plate assay, and loss of ability to grow in minimal medium. The latter two of these methods are considered to be more objective and reliable in determining the degree of variability induced by UV radiation in this fungus. The highest frequency of variants is obtained at UV dosages which reduce spore survival to levels of 5 to 15%.  相似文献

Reconstruction of orbital wall fenestrations with polyglactin 910 film   总被引:1,自引:0,他引:1  
Medial orbital wall fenestrations were created bilaterally in 16 adult cats. The fenestrations were reconstructed with polyglactin 910 film, Dacron-reinforced silicone sheeting, or no implant. Polyglactin 910 was found to be well tolerated in this traumatized area of paranasal sinus bone and soft tissue and was totally absorbed in 4 months. Dacron-reinforced silicone sheeting induced a long-standing acute inflammatory reaction in a similar milieu. Partial osseus replacement of the orbital fenestrations occurred in all animals, but it was accompanied by distortion and erosion in apposition to the silicone sheeting. The study does not answer the question of whether orbital contour will be maintained on a long-term basis adjacent to a pneumatized sinus following reconstruction with a bioabsorbable implant.  相似文献
